Help Students and Families Flourish

All too often, children in need of mental health services don’t have access to care due to financial, societal or family barriers. The advocate they need is beyond their reach.
Enter the school social worker – a trained mental health professional who can:
- Support students with mental health struggles
- Teach social-emotional strategies
- Connect families to needed resources
- Provide prevention programs for school violence, substance abuse, and teen pregnancy
- Help schools develop effective safety plans.
In short, they fill the gap to make lasting positive change for children at a developmentally crucial age. Are you willing to fill the gap?

Choose Between Two Paths
Integrated MSW + School Social Work Program
You can complete the school social work program as a part of the Master of Social Work (MSW) program at George Fox without taking any extra courses or taking longer to finish your master’s degree. If you don’t already have your MSW and want to be a school social worker, this is the way to go.
Stand-Alone School Social Work Program
If you already have an MSW from a CSWE-accredited university and want to become a school social worker, our stand-alone option is a better fit for you.
In just eight months, you can earn all requirements to prepare you for licensure as a school social worker in Oregon.
The path is ideal for people working in schools with an emergency or restricted school social work license or for social workers who want to start working in a school setting.
Format
While most classes can be completed online asynchronously (on your own schedule), a few will require live online participation during evening hours. Additionally, students are encouraged to attend courses in person at 最新麻豆视频's Portland Center three Saturdays per semester. (For those who are unable to attend classes in person, the faculty will offer an alternative online option.)
In addition, students must complete 400-plus hours of in-person practicum in a K-12 school setting. They have the option of completing those hours in their community and/or at their current place of employment if the school setting meets TSPC qualifications.

Steps to Becoming a Licensed Social Worker in Oregon
- Complete a school social work licensure preparation program, like this one at 最新麻豆视频
- Complete the TSPC application and pay the associated fee
- Pass a fingerprint background check
- Submit an official copy of your MSW transcript to TSPC, either from George Fox or from your MSW-granting institution
- Submit proof of completing a TSPC-approved school social work licensure preparation program to TSPC, consisting of official transcripts and program completion report (PCR) from your school
